1. Definition and objectives

The historical study, as described in this article, consists in identifying the structures, operating procedures or events that existed or occurred at an industrial site in the past, and whose nature presents a potential impact on human health and the environment.

The historical and documentary study has three main components:

  • a detailed tour of the site ;

  • environmental knowledge of the site, its surroundings and their vulnerability;

  • historical analysis of the site.

These elements must allow :

  • geographically and chronologically locate the surface areas most likely to be polluted;
